jenkins新增节点Checking Java version in the PATH bash: java: command not found
时间: 2023-05-12 08:06:21 浏览: 71
这个问题是关于 Jenkins 的,它提示找不到 Java 命令。这可能是因为 Java 没有被正确安装或者 Java 的路径没有被正确配置。您需要检查 Java 是否已经正确安装,并且在系统的 PATH 环境变量中是否已经添加了 Java 的路径。如果您已经安装了 Java,但是仍然无法找到 Java 命令,您可以尝试重新安装 Java 或者重新配置 PATH 环境变量。
相关问题
-bash: python3: command not found
您在使用命令行时遇到的问题"-bash: python3: command not found"是因为系统无法找到python3的路径。您可以使用以下步骤解决这个问题:
1. 在命令行中输入"which python3",找到python3的路径。例如,路径为"/usr/local/bin/python3"。
2. 在jenkins的命令中更改为"/usr/local/bin/python3 run.py",这样jenkins就能找到python3并执行脚本了。
bash: kubectl: command not found...
这个错误提示表明在执行shell脚本时,系统找不到kubectl命令。这通常是因为Jenkins服务器上没有安装kubectl。要解决这个问题,可以按照以下步骤在Linux服务器上安装kubectl:
1.使用curl命令下载kubectl二进制文件:
```shell
curl -LO https://storage.googleapis.com/kubernetes-release/release/$(curl -s https://storage.googleapis.com/kubernetes-release/release/stable.txt)/bin/linux/amd64/kubectl
```
2.将kubectl二进制文件移动到/usr/local/bin目录下,并添加可执行权限:
```shell
sudo mv kubectl /usr/local/bin/
sudo chmod +x /usr/local/bin/kubectl
```
3.验证kubectl是否安装成功:
```shell
kubectl version --client
```
如果kubectl安装成功,将会输出客户端版本信息。